Biography

Thaddeus Howze is a California-based IT director, author and transmedia producer whose non-fiction has appeared in online publications such as The Enemy, Black Enterprise, The Good Men Project, Urban Times, Quora, Astronaut.com and the SciFiStackExchange.com, one of New York Times 50 Best Websites.

In addition to his non fiction, Howze is an accomplished speculative fiction writer whose work has appeared in Medium.com, The Magill Review, Au Courant Press Journal and Flashflood, as well as numerous anthologies including:

Awesome Allshorts: Last days & Lost Ways (2014)
The Future is Short (2014)
Visions of Leaving Earth (2014)
Mothership: Tales of Afrofuturism and Beyond (2014)
Genesis Science Fiction (2013),
Scraps (2012)
Possibilities (2012)

He maintains a web presence using WordPress writing nonfiction, science and technology articles at A Matter of Scale (https://ebonstorm.wordpress.com).

His speculative fiction work can be found at Hub City Blues (https://hubcityblues.com).

He has published two books, Hayward’s Reach (2011) and Broken Glass (2013).
